This performance is a public concert organized by the All Japan Piano Teachers Association (Pitina). Pianist Eiko Sudo will join us to unravel the works of world-renowned composer Ryuichi Sakamoto. From his early masterpiece "East Wind," to the famous film scores "The Last Emperor" and "Sheltering Sky," to the delicate sounding "20220302 - sarabande" from his later years, the concert will feature a number of gems of piano music that have been loved throughout the ages. This is a rare opportunity to enjoy Ryuichi Sakamoto's worldview of silence and harmony in a performance by Eiko Sudo with her rich sensibility.
